Kerry Kennedy, sister of Robert F. Kennedy Jr., has attacked her brother for endorsing the former president Trump, saying it's a "inexplicable effort" to damage their father's legacy. 
Following his own campaign suspension, Kennedy's brother welcomed Trump on MSNBC's "Inside with Jen Psaki," which drew criticism from her sister.
